What Makes a Good NTE Team?

Building a strong team in Neverness to Everness starts with the Esper Cycle — the game's core reaction system. Each character has a Cycle Gauge that fills through attacks and Skills, and when a character swaps in with a full gauge, it triggers a reaction based on adjacent elements on the reaction wheel. The six base reactions include Blossom, Remora, Nova, Scorch, Stain, and Hexed, while the two advanced reactions — Charge (Remora + Blossom) and Discord (Scorch + Nova) — are the most impactful and should anchor every serious team build.

Core Support Characters to Know First

Before diving into team comps, five characters form the backbone of most competitive lineups:

Haniel

Haniel

  • A dedicated ATK buffer whose Skill, Ultimate, and signature Arc stack multiple attack boosts for the whole team. Her Psyche element enables Nova, Stain, and Discord reactions.

Sakiri

Sakiri

  • A near-universal support who buffs team ATK, amplifies Scorch DoT damage, and provides the best enemy grouping in the game via her Press Skill.

Jiuyuan

Jiuyuan

  •  Significantly boosts Blossom output, provides grouping, and offers passive healing at higher Awakening levels. A cornerstone of any Blossom team.

Zero

Esper Zero

  • The only character with an instant 100-point Cycle Gauge fill via Skill. Best enabler for Blossom and Charge reactions. Can be built for team ATK (Speedy Hedgehog set) or personal Cycle Intensity damage (Cosmos set).

Daffodill

Daffodill

  • The sole Chaos element character is required to trigger Scorch, Nova, and Discord. Also one of the game's top breakers, with a Phantom Step parry mechanic that refills her Ultimate on activation.

Best Neverness to Everness Team Compositions

 

1. Mono Blossom Team (Top-Tier)

Zero's instant Cycle fill, combined with Hotori's Skill replay, triples Blossom triggers. Nanally fires additional hits per Blossom while Jiuyuan doubles output and raises the active cap. Hotori's time-stop Ultimate freezes the stage timer, pushing effective DPS above all other comps.

2. Lacrimosa Scorch DoT Team (Top-Tier)

Built around stacking as many DoT instances as possible. Sakiri amplifies DoT damage per active debuff on the enemy, while Adler adds random debuffs with every Scorch proc. The fourth slot is fully flexible — Fadia for survivability.

3. Hyper Chiz Charge Team

Chiz accumulates Grain through basic attacks and converts it into burst damage via her Skill, with Charge keeping her Ultimate uptime consistently high. Hathor builds damage stacks through dodges and Skill use — stay on her until the buff window expires, as switching off ends the state immediately. Jiuyuan handles grouping and Blossom while Hotori accelerates Cycle Gauge generation.

4. Mono Scorch Team (F2P-Friendly)

Baicang doubles Scorch application via his Power Words, Sakiri stacks DoT multipliers, and Daffodill anchors the Chaos element while passively breaking enemy bars. Note that Baicang consumes HP when generating Power Words but recovers it by consuming Blessed Seals. Swap Haniel in for Adler to enable Discord for aggressive boss breaking.

5. Best F2P Starter Team

A fully free team built around Blossom, Charge, and Hexed reactions. Zero's instant Cycle fill drives constant Blossom procs with Mint, while Skia enables Remora for Charge. Adler contributes Hexed and provides shielding. Once available through City Tycoon, Chiz slots naturally into the main DPS role.

Team-Building Tips

  • Always keep your elemental lane intact — a flex pick that preserves reactions beats a stronger character who breaks the chain.
  • Charge and Discord are the two most powerful advanced reactions; build at least one of them into every team.
  • The fourth slot should solve a specific problem: survivability (Fadia), ATK amplification (Haniel or Sakiri), or break (Daffodill or Adler).
  • Save Ultimates for stagger windows — burst damage against a broken enemy multiplies effective output.
  • For Beyond the Rails, you need two full teams of four with no character overlap. Prioritize characters that appear in only one of your teams.
